titleOfInvention | P-benzoquinone stripping tower |
abstract | The utility model discloses a p-benzoquinone stripping tower, which relates to the technical field of chemical industry and comprises a lower tower body and an upper tower body arranged at the top of the lower tower body, wherein a supporting ring is horizontally arranged at the top of the inner wall of the lower tower body, an inverted flow guide hopper is arranged at the bottom of the inner wall of the upper tower body, a flow distribution plate for the peripheral dissipation of gas is arranged at the top end of the flow guide hopper, a flow guide ring plate is vertically arranged at the edge of the top of the flow guide hopper, and an impurity removal component for scraping impurities is arranged inside the flow guide hopper; the utility model has simple structure, and through the arrangement of the guide flow hopper, the flow distribution plate and the guide ring plate, the condition of insufficient desilting of the existing benzoquinone crystallization is conveniently and effectively improved, and the equipment operation and the production cost are effectively reduced; the manganese mud particles can conveniently fall to the bottom of the stripping tower along the diversion port at the top of the diversion hopper again; impurity in the stripping gas is convenient for prevent through edulcoration subassembly that impurity is detained on the water conservancy diversion fill inner wall, and then reaches and gets rid of the impurity effect. |
